Fedora 14
Recently Fedora 14, code name Laughlin, the operating system and platform based on Linux, developed by the Project Fedora and sponsored by Red Hat, has been released in final version.

Now you can download this new version of Fedora which brings some updates, improvements, some new features and also some bug fixes.

So what's new in Fedora 14 :

Linux Kernel 2.6.35

integration of GNOME 2.32, KDE 4.5, XFCE 4.6.2...

integration of SPICE which aims to provide a complete open source solution for interaction with virtualized desktops and provides high-quality remote access to QEMU virtual machines.

libjpeg-turbo as a replacement for libjpeg

update of Python 2 which is now in version 2.7 and also QT in version 4.7

availability of PyQt4 for Python 3

the availability for Fedora 14 on EC2, the public Cloud computing plateform
